Overview

  • This position is physically located in the Philippines in support of LOGCAP***

Under the supervision of the Task Order Manager, the Logistics Manager provides management and oversight of all Logistics functions at the assigned site in support of the LOGCAP V Subic Bay Task Order; specific activities include but are not limited to: COSIS Storage, Transportation, Crane/MHE Operations Supply, Container Operations, Equipment and Vehicle Maintenance. Serves as a key customer contact for local activities, establishes milestones, monitors adherence to plans and schedules, identifies problems and obtains solutions, such as allocation of resources. Ensures all Logistics personnel, to include subcontractors, are trained, qualified and certified as needed to perform the requirements of the contract in an efficient, safe and cost-effective manner under the requirements specified in individual sections of the Performance Work Statement (PWS). #clearance
